Pascal's law or the Principle of transmission of fluid-pressure states that "pressure exerted anywhere in a confined incompressible fluid is transmitted equally in all directions throughout the fluid such that the pressure ratio (initial difference) remains the same."


1. A small piston with area A1 = 40 cm acts in a cylinder to lift a larger piston A2 = 550 cm Find the force on the small piston (F1) if the pressure in the system is 6400 pascals.


 2. Find the weight the large piston could lift (F2) at a pressure of 6400 pascals.


 3. If a force of F1 300 newtons acted on the smaller piston, what is the force F2 that the larger piston could support?
